Output 573d4f5726235706bd0802160eebb0183b4183bc8f85cfccc23287b1b0c9bdec:12

value
951636
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7579cf0c33f4f1cf6136288f2b43f1d2893b6e1a OP_EQUAL
address
3CQAuQkZaM2doq6BFzSzEgN6dCDaWb7bvr
transaction
573d4f5726235706bd0802160eebb0183b4183bc8f85cfccc23287b1b0c9bdec
spent
true